Have you ever gotten to the place where you feel completely over your head? (If not then take some risks!) I would say that “over my head” has been the best way to describe the way I feel in regards to PNCC for the past three years.
Keep something in mind…Pointe North is the ONLY church that I have ever served as the senior pastor. People come by and see what God is doing here and say, “I am amazed.” I ALWAYS say the same thing–no one is more amazed by this than me!!!
SO…how does a leader lead in situations like this? It’s very simple–we’ve GOT to be students for the rest of our lives and LEARN all that we can…whatever that takes!!!
As I look back over the past 23 years of my life as a Christ Follower/minister I have noticed a pattern in me…and I am just being honest here…I have always sought to get around other people and places that are successful and seek to learn as much as I can. I understand that when God was passing out wisdom He skipped right over me…and so I have to “get” as much as I can from other people!!!
I will admit that there are times when I have been tempted to back away from “learning” and just focus on leading…but the Holy Spirit will not allow me to do that. Back in January I was struggling with whether or not to attend a conference in May. The Holy Spirit then led me to take as many people as we could to the "Unleash" conference. That was an awesome trip and experience for me and the 50 volunteers that went.Learning takes WORK…and God has been very clear to me that the day I stop growing is the day I HURT the church that I am leading.
Learning COSTS! It costs money and time. You have to be willing to spend both in order to continue to grow...no excuses! See, there is a verse in Proverbs that keeps me in this attitude.
"If you love learning, you love the discipline that goes with it - How shortsighted to refuse correction!" Proverbs 12:1
